On , OSHA opened an unprogrammed Related safety inspection of STAFF RIGHT, INC. in 421 SAWMILL COURT, SUWANEE, GA 30024 (NAICS 561320). OSHA activity number 341549988.

What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.22(b)(2): Permanent aisles and passageways were not appropriately marked.    On or about 6/7/16, at the Gwinnett Lumber Remanufacturing job site located in Suwanee, Georgia, where pedestrian and power industrial truck traffic both occur the employer has not ensured permanent aisles and passageways are appropriately marked or designated.

29 CFR 1910.147(c)(7)(i)(B): Affected employees were not instructed in the purpose and use of the energy control procedure.    On 6/7/16, at the Gwinnett Lumber Remanufacturing facility located in Suwanee, Georgia, the employer did not provide LOTO training to Affected employees working in the facility when Gwinnett Lumber Remanufacturing employees provided service and maintenance to production equipment at the site.

29 CFR 1910.157(g)(1): An educational program was not provided for all employees to familiarize them with the general principles of fire extinguisher use and the hazards involved with incipient stage fire fighting.    On or about 6/7/16, at the Gwinnett Lumber Remanufacturing job site located in Suwanee, Georgia, the employer did not implement a training program for the use of fire extinguishers for incipient level use when employees were expected to use them.

29 CFR 1910.212(a)(1): One or more methods of machine guarding was not provided to protect the operator and other employees in the machine area from hazards such as those created by ingoing nip points, rotating parts, and flying chips and sparks.  On or about 6/7/16, at the Gwinnett Lumber Remanufacturing job site located in Suwanee, Georgia, in the production area, production equipment was not properly guarded leaving various hazards exposed. Instances included:  a - Pallet Notcher Pusher Hold Mechanism b - Yates American Planer - at gear mechanism on conveyor input side

29 CFR 1910.212(a)(3)(ii): Point of operation guards were not designed and constructed as to prevent the operator from having any part of their body in the danger zone during the operating cycle.  On or about 6/7/16, at the Gwinnett Lumber Remanufacturing job site located in Suwanee, Georgia, in the production area, the employer did not ensure points of operation were guarded on machines. Instances included:  a - Pallet Notcher Saw
